Walking by Faith: Exhaling Doubt and Embracing the Unseen

 


Greetings, beloved congregation! Today, we gather in the presence of the Lord to explore a powerful message of faith found in 2 Corinthians 5:7. The verse reminds us, "For we walk by faith, not by sight." In a world that often demands tangible evidence, God calls us to exhale doubt and embrace the transformative power of faith. Join me as we delve into the significance of walking by faith, stepping beyond what is seen, and trusting in the promises of our faithful God.

Moving Beyond the Seen

Our natural inclination is to rely on what we can see and understand. However, God calls us to move beyond the limitations of our human perception. Walking by faith means acknowledging that there is a spiritual realm at work, beyond what our physical senses can detect. It requires us to exhale doubt and open ourselves to the unseen, knowing that God's plans and purposes are greater than what meets the eye.

Trusting in God's Promises

Faith is not blind; it is grounded in the promises of God. In His Word, God has revealed His faithfulness, love, and provision for His people. As we exhale doubt, we can inhale the truth of His promises, knowing that He is a God who keeps His word. When we trust in His promises, we find the strength and courage to navigate life's challenges, knowing that He is faithful to fulfill what He has spoken.

Embracing a Faith-Filled Journey

Walking by faith is not a one-time event but a continuous journey. It is a lifestyle of surrender and trust in the One who holds our future. As we exhale doubt and embrace faith, we embark on a transformative adventure, guided by the Holy Spirit. It is through this journey that we witness miracles, experience divine provision, and grow in intimacy with our Heavenly Father. Each step taken in faith draws us closer to the abundant life God has prepared for us.

As we conclude this sermon, let us remember that walking by faith is an invitation to exhale doubt and inhale the assurance of God's promises. By fixing our eyes on the unseen, we align ourselves with the eternal purposes of God. Trusting in His faithfulness, we can navigate life's uncertainties with unwavering confidence. So, dear friends, let us walk by faith, allowing the transformative power of God to shape our lives and lead us into His abundant blessings.
